Description

Pasta with a little zing!

Ingredients

  • 12 ounces, weight Penne Rigate
  • 2 Tablespoons Olive Oil, Divided
  • 1 whole Red Pepper, Chopped
  • ½ cups Onion, Diced
  • 2 cloves Garlic, Minced
  • 1 whole Lemon, Juiced
  • 1 teaspoon Italian Se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on Oregano
  • 2 cups Baby Spinach
  • 1 teaspoon Salt, Or To Taste
  • ¼ teaspoons Pepper
  • 1 teaspoon Red Pepper Flakes
  • ¼ cups Parmesan

Preparation

Cook pasta according to package directions. Add 1 tablespoon of olive oil to a pan and saute red pepper and onion for about 5 minutes over medium/low heat. Add garlic and cook for 1 minute.

Once pasta is complete, add the pasta to the red pepper and onion mixture. Add lemon juice, the remaining tablespoon of olive oil, Italian seasoning and oregano. Mix well. Add in baby spinach and cook over low heat for about 4–5 minutes, until spinach wilts. Add salt, pepper and red pepper flakes.

You can add parmesan to the dish or to each individual serving. Adjust salt and pepper to your liking. Enjoy!

Thank you, this was delicious and has all my favorite pasta ingredients in it! Lemon and spinach is always a winner! I added more garlic (4 cloves)and shallot instead of onion simply because I had some to use up. The lemon flavor was light, very good and I added a little zest from the lemon for a bit more of the lemon flavor. My husband and 8 yr old son enjoyed this very much , as did I. I served it as a side dish with crispy balsamic chicken and garlic bread. I will use this recipe regularly, thanks again! :)
